Full Description

This exam addresses ethological approaches to understanding animal behavior, emphasizing observation in natural contexts.

These approaches provide insight into the adaptive significance of behaviors and contribute to a more comprehensive understanding of behavioral science.

Assessment will focus on students' capabilities to discuss and analyze ethological studies and their relevance to both animal and human psychology.

Students should prepare to present and critique key ethological research findings.
